A dynamic eq makes for the best dresser. Use the preview button to hear only what you are cutting to help find the silence then scan between 5k and 7k for the loudest Tss sounds and reduce by about 3db. Also nothing beats manually adjusting your vocal recording volume peaks before it even gets to a compressor. Allows for a much more natural sounding and upfront vocals. Lastly a harmonic saturator really helps adds 3 dimensionality to the vocals. Cheers

People saying the chain sucks but it isn't terrible, it's just standard. I do think the plugins are out of order tho. It's usually best to de-ess before comp cuz de-essers use dynamic changes to find what it should reduce. Putting it on a compressed signal can make it harder for it to work cuz the sibilance peaks have already been slightly smoothed out. Also adding an EQ before comp typically gives you a warmer tone, where adding an EQ after comp usually gives you a clearer tone, so I PERSONALLY would comp before EQ, but it could depend on the song
